CS/컴퓨터 구조

[컴퓨터 구조] 2-1 0과 1로 숫자를 표현하는 방법

서니션 2024. 5. 8. 15:36
728x90
반응형
이 글을 혼자 공부하는 컴퓨터구조 + 운영체제 (한빛미디어) 책을 읽고 혼자 공부한 내용입니다.
잘못 이해한 부분이 있을 수 있고, 문제가 있는 부분 댓글로 알려주시면 수정하겠습니다.

 

정보 단위

 

비트 : 0과 1을 나타내는 가장 작은 정보 단위

n비트는 2^n가지 정보를 표현할 수 있음

 

바이트 : 8개의 비트를 묶은 단위, 비트보다 한 단계 큰 단위

 

워드 : CPU가 한 번에 처리할 수 있는 데이터 크기

워드의 절반 크기를 하프 워드, 1배 크기를 풀 워드, 2배 크기를 더블 워드라고 함

 


이진법

 

수학에서 0과 1만으로 모든 숫자를 표현하는 방법

숫자가 1을 넘어가는 시점에 자리 올림을 하면 됨

 

 

이진수의 음수 표현

'모든 0과 1을 뒤집고, 거기에 1을 더한 값'

 

실제 이진수만 보고는 양수인지 음수인지 구분하기 어려워서 '플래그'라는 컴퓨터 내부에서 알 수 있는 것이 있음

 


십육진법

 

15를 넘어가는 시점에 자리 올림을 하는 숫자 표현 방식

 

십육진법을 사용하는 주된 이유 중 하나는, 이진수를 십육진수로 십육진수를 이진수로 변환하기 쉽기 때문이다

 

 

728x90
반응형